Contrast

#e38cd0 as textRatioAAAA largeAAAFix
Aaon white
2.35:1failfailfail
  • AA: use #cd32ac as the text (4.52:1)
  • AAA: use #98257f as the text (7.23:1)
  • AA: or shift the background to #3d3d3d (4.62:1)
  • AAA: or shift the background to #1f1f1f (7.01:1)
Aaon black
8.93:1passpasspassPasses AAA — no fix needed.

Fixes keep hue and saturation and move lightness only, so the suggestion stays on-brand. Ratios are symmetric: the same numbers apply with #e38cd0 as the background.
